Understanding The Importance Of A Class 1 Biological Safety Cabinet

In the world of laboratory research, safety is paramount. When dealing with potentially hazardous biological materials, having the right equipment to protect both researchers and the environment is essential. One such piece of equipment is the class 1 biological safety cabinet.

A class 1 biological safety cabinet, commonly referred to as a BSC, is a type of containment device used to protect laboratory workers and the surrounding environment from exposure to potentially harmful biological agents. These cabinets are designed to provide a safe work environment for researchers working with biological materials such as bacteria, viruses, and other hazardous substances.

The main function of a class 1 biological safety cabinet is to protect laboratory workers from exposure to airborne particles and pathogens while working with biological materials. The cabinet works by creating a negative pressure environment, which prevents airborne contaminants from escaping and spreading to the surrounding areas. This is achieved through a series of filters that capture and trap particles and pathogens before they can be released into the atmosphere.

There are three main types of biological safety cabinets, classified based on their level of protection and design features. Class 1 Biological Safety Cabinets are the most basic type and offer a moderate level of protection. These cabinets are typically used for low to moderate-risk biological materials and provide personnel and environmental protection, but not product protection.

One of the key features of a Class 1 Biological Safety Cabinet is the presence of a HEPA (High-Efficiency Particulate Air) filter. This filter is designed to capture and trap particles as small as 0.3 microns in size, including bacteria, viruses, and other hazardous biological agents. The HEPA filter is critical in preventing airborne contaminants from escaping the cabinet and posing a risk to laboratory workers.

In addition to the HEPA filter, Class 1 Biological Safety Cabinets also have a constant airflow system that helps maintain a clean and safe work environment. The airflow is directed inward towards the researcher, providing a barrier between them and any potentially hazardous materials being handled inside the cabinet. This airflow system also helps to remove any airborne contaminants and prevent them from escaping the cabinet.
